编译提醒我使用了未经检查或不安全的操作,这是为什么
import java.awt.*;
import javax.swing.*;
public class Gui7 extends JFrame{
JLabel bq1,bq2;
JComboBox xl1;
JList lb1;
JPanel mb1,mb2;
JScrollPane gd;
public static void main(String [] args) {
Gui7 aa = new Gui7();
}
public Gui7() {
mb1 = new JPanel();
mb2 = new JPanel();
String[] jk = {"shanghai","beijing","nanjing","ningbo"};
xl1 = new JComboBox(jk);
String[] xl = {"high","college","zhuanke","shuoshi","boshi"};
lb1= new JList(xl);
lb1.setVisibleRowCount(3);
gd =new JScrollPane(lb1);
bq1 = new JLabel("Location");
bq2 = new JLabel("xueli");
this.setLayout(new GridLayout(2,1));
mb1.add(bq1);
mb1.add(xl1);
mb2.add(bq2);
mb2.add(gd);
this.add(mb1);
this.add(mb2);
this.setTitle("用户调查");
this.setSize(300,150);
this.setLocation(150,150);
this.setResizable(false);
this.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
this.setVisible(true);
}
}